Under normal circumstances, interferon does not directly exert bactericidal effects against anaerobic bacteria. Instead, it is primarily used as an adjunctive therapy for conditions caused by anaerobic bacterial infections, with the main goal of enhancing the body's own anti-infective capacity and improving overall treatment outcomes. A detailed analysis is as follows:

The core treatment for anaerobic bacterial infections relies on antibiotics, which can directly inhibit the growth and reproduction of anaerobic bacteria or kill the pathogens outright. Interferon, however, works through a completely different mechanism—it does not act directly on anaerobic bacteria. Rather, it modulates the body's immune function, stimulates the activity of immune cells, enhances the body's ability to recognize, phagocytose, and clear anaerobic bacteria, and can also reduce local inflammatory responses triggered by the infection. Particularly in patients with compromised immune function suffering from anaerobic infections, interferon can effectively compensate for weakened immunity, help antibiotics work more effectively, and shorten the duration of illness.

It should be clearly understood that interferon is only an auxiliary treatment and must never replace the central role of antibiotics. Its use must strictly follow established medical guidelines. Additionally, proper cleaning and care of the infected area should be maintained in daily life, keeping the site dry and hygienic to minimize bacterial proliferation and further support recovery.
